What is meant by vb net framework?

VB.NET stands for Visual Basic.NET, and it is a computer programming language developed by Microsoft. ... VB.NET is an object-oriented programming language. This means that it supports the features of object-oriented programming which include encapsulation, polymorphism, abstraction, and inheritance.

What is .NET framework and how it works?

Net Framework is a software development platform developed by Microsoft for building and running Windows applications. ... Net framework consists of developer tools, programming languages, and libraries to build desktop and web applications. It is also used to build websites, web services, and games.

What is VB.NET explain with features?

NET (VB.NET) is an object-oriented computer programming language implemented on the . NET Framework. ... Everything in VB.NET is an object, including all of the primitive types (Short, Integer, Long, String, Boolean, etc.) and user-defined types, events, and even assemblies. All objects inherits from the base class Object.

What is difference between .NET framework and Visual Studio?

Visual Studio . NET is an application-development tool for writing applications; the . NET Framework provides the infrastructure required to run those applications. Technically, you don't need Visual Studio .

Why is .NET used?

Net is referred to as a framework, which is used for developing the software application using different languages. ... It provides language interoperability because of which each language can be used in other languages. The dot net framework consists of a class library, which is named as Framework Class Library (FCL).

Is VB.NET and .NET same?

VB.Net and C#.Net are LANGUAGES, like C, Smalltalk etc. ASP.NET is a framework for making web applications. It is part of the ,NET framework, but if you read the langauge specifications for VB.NET or C# then you find not a single reference to ASP.NET in them.

What is Visual Basic used for?

Visual Basic for Applications is a computer programming language developed and owned by Microsoft. With VBA you can create macros to automate repetitive word- and data-processing functions, and generate custom forms, graphs, and reports. VBA functions within MS Office applications; it is not a stand-alone product.

Is VB.NET and C# same?

Though C# and VB.NET are syntactically very different, that is where the differences mostly end. Microsoft developed both of these languages to be part of the same . NET Framework development platform. They are both developed, managed, and supported by the same language development team at Microsoft.

Is VB.NET a dead language?

Visual Basic (VB.NET) will continue to be supported by Microsoft. (It's not dead.) The language will no longer have new features added to it.

Which software is used for .NET programming?

Microsoft Visual Studio

Not only can you use the Microsoft . NET Framework in Visual Studio, but Visual Studio is built with . NET. The program achieves many innovations using programs like Windows API, Windows Forms, Windows Presentation Foundation, Windows Store, and Microsoft Silverlight.

Is .NET easy to learn?

NET is easy to learn. ... Since C# is a derivative of C++: one of the basic programming languages, parallel to Java, therefore it is easier for Java professionals to learn . NET which is primarily written and engineered in C#.

How many languages are supported by Net framework?

NET Framework supports more than 60 programming languages in which 11 programming languages are designed and developed by Microsoft.

Why VB Net is not popular?

For professional developers it is not a very popular language as the syntax is a bit bulky and clumsy. Languages like C#, Java, C++ and others are more popular among professional developers. However, you don't have to be a developer to write applications.
